Deduction of employees' compensation from common law damages
  • 11 Aug 2023

    LEUNG SHUI CHEONG v. AU CHUNG YIN JIMMY

    Citation
    [2023] HKCA 963
    Court
    Court of Appeal
    Case number
    CACV391/2022

    Section 25(1) governs claims against a third party tortfeasor; the employer’s entitlement to recover 'any sum which he is obliged to pay as a result of the accident' is the compensation as assessed in the Form 5 unless the statutory objection or appeal mechanisms are invoked in time. The master erred in re‑assessing the Form 5 apportionment under section 26; the Form 5 sum (subject to the proviso cap) must be relied upon for deduction and, on the facts, the deduction extinguished the plaintiff's claim so net damages are nil.
